Because Luck is 29, man. He's not old but he's older than Alex was when we acquired him. And like Smith, he's had a serious shoulder injury. Do you really think his ceiling is anywhere close to what it was 5 years ago? Luck has 3 years before he physically begins to decline. The team around him is ass and frankly that decline may be sooner/sharper than we expected given the nature of his injury. Chad Pennington simply never recovered. That's the nightmare. Any kind of shoulder surgery for a QB substantially alters his trajectory, IMO. Darnold is the only truly high-end talent I see out there. Mayfield will be a Jay Cutler type, IMO. He'll play with his hair on fire and be the kind of player that idiots thought Mahomes would be but without generational arm talent. |
